Dalvin Cook is headed to Baltimore ahead of the Ravens' playoff run.

The Ravens struck a deal with Cook on Thursday, just days after he was waived by the New York Jets, according to ESPN's Adam Schefter. Cook will join the Ravens in time for the playoffs.

Cook had signed a one-year, $7 million deal to join the Jets this past offseason. The 28-year-old ran for 214 yards on 67 carries in 15 games with the Jets, all of which were career lows.

The Ravens will host the Pittsburgh Steelers in their regular season finale on Saturday afternoon. Baltimore has already locked up the No. 1 seed in the AFC, and will have a first-round bye and home field advantage throughout the playoffs.
